Linda - you may have a spyware issue. Search , download,=20
install and run Spybot (It's a free program) and let it=20
search your drives (Click on the hourglass) and delete=20
any spware items that show up. Additionally here's a way=20
to check to see if you have the "Huntbar" installed. If=20
you do remove it as it is spyware.


Uninstall procedure
Uninstall HuntBar from "Add/Remove Programs" in the=20
Windows=AE Control Panel. Look for entries=20
called 'MSIETS', 'Internet 404', 'Tools for Internet=20
Explorer', 'Search Toolbar'. You can also uninstall it=20
manually.
